Newspaper advertisement: "Blacksmithing. The subscriber respectfully informs the inhabitants of Houston and its vicinity, that he has rented the blacksmith shop of Mesrs. Grainger and Ackerman and is now ready to do all kinds of blacksmith work, repairing gun locks, and locks and keys of all descriptions. Mending copper, brass, tin, &c. Ed. M. Garner. apr 15 daw tf 643"
